Northern Region - Victim / Witness Assistance Program
Greater Sudbury
Show More
144 Pine St, Unit 206
Greater Sudbury, ON, P3C 1X3
Greater Sudbury, ON, P3C 1X3
Short Description
COVID19 Update: Court case backlog -- clients may experience difficulties contacting local offices and should leave a message with return phone number; VWAP staff will return voicemail as soon as possible
- Provides information and assistance to support participation in the criminal court process
- Services begin once police have laid charges and continue until the court case is over
- Case-specific information (court dates, bail conditions)
- Court preparation
- Needs assessment
- Emotional support
- Crisis intervention
- Referrals to community agencies
Provides financial and court-based supports to enable victims of crime and families of homicide victims to attend court, including:
- Travel arrangements and expenses
- Language interpretation
- Real-time captioning or other equipment for victims with disabilities

Victim Crisis Assistance Ontario
Greater Sudbury
Show More
190 Brady St, 1st Fl
Greater Sudbury, ON, P3E 1C7
Greater Sudbury, ON, P3E 1C7
Short Description
- Offers on-site early intervention and crisis intervention
- Provides needs assessment, safety planning and referrals to community services
- Offers enhanced support for vulnerable victims
- Provides assistance with applications to VQRP+
Victim Quick Response Program+ (VQRP+)
Provides assistance with emergency expenses related to the incident, including:
- home safety
- accommodation
- meals
- transportation
- basic necessities
- dependent care costs
- counselling
- traditional Indigenous health services
- cellular phones
- vision care
- dental care
- aids for victims with disabilities
- interpretation services
- crime scene cleanup
- government/medical documents
- funeral expenses
Additional assistance for victims of human trafficking includes:
- storage locker
- tattoo removal
- treatment at a recovery facility
Note: No direct reimbursement to victims for above supports
Financial support also available for:
- victims who sustained serious physical injuries during a crime
- parents of child homicide victims
- spouses of homicide victims
